Output fa66d0d30ddfa0018fdbe8df6a148f11abb53001ff55153207f55e9ee402bae3:1

value
2624088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b0a680e3e9fa09112d95bfa92197ec0704825c OP_EQUAL
address
3DyC68k1HZ64j58ghL9bhMJmvgJM8jZHvp
transaction
fa66d0d30ddfa0018fdbe8df6a148f11abb53001ff55153207f55e9ee402bae3
spent
true